Output d68239fae05b8af3ea2fb5adc419d3a1f7fa6e5e7be904ccfd30985106c0223b:0

value
16400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f29c86ac2ad72f8363280b62b37b26caa3cb1ab OP_EQUAL
address
3BpnyxmJKWAXfCKZyT82BEAqdPWL9w5AqD
transaction
d68239fae05b8af3ea2fb5adc419d3a1f7fa6e5e7be904ccfd30985106c0223b
confirmations
445323
spent
true